Abstract

[Object]: Detect whether different concentrations of Chinese herbs compound polysaccharides (CPS), astragaluspolysaccharides (APS) and angeulica polysaccharides (ASP), epimedium herb polysaccharides (EPS) have effects onthe immunity function of healthy Roman chicken. [Method]: 260 one-day-old chickens were divided into thirteengroups randomly, 20 birds each group. The physiological saline, Chinese herbs compound polysaccharides, APS, ASPor EPS had been hypodermically injected for seven days continuously, and the blood was drawn on the 7th, 14th, 21st,28th, 35th, 42nd, 49th and 56th day to evaluate the activity of the translation rate of blood lymphocyte and AI-HI antibodytiters in chickens. [Result]: The results of the experiment showed that the translation rate of blood lymphocyte andAI-HI antibody titers increased markedly after the use of Chinese herbs compound polysaccharides, APS, ASP and EPSto the chickens. Chinese herbs compound polysaccharides had more effective function improving the translation rate ofblood lymphocyte and AI-HI antibody titers than others. [Conclusion]: The Chinese herbs compound polysaccharides,APS, ASP and EPS could promote the immunity function of the chickens. The Chinese herbs compoundpolysaccharides were the strangest one among them.

Introduction

Chicken is sensitive to many infectious diseases, such as Newcastle Disease, Avian Influenza (AI) and Infectious Bursa Diseases, which caused high mortality and economic loss world widely. There are no effective drugs to cure these diseases and the most effective way is to use Vaccines to prevent the occurrence of these. Them another problem comes which is that, vaccines is not always as effective as people expected. Many papers in recent years showed that polysaccharides can enhance immunity and have no obvious side effect.
